Sam Harris & Objective Morality
Sam Harris argues that morality has to do with happiness and well-being of humans and other conscious beings. This is objective and can be quantified.
We can also determine what changes this happiness. Actions that increase this happiness are moral. Actions that decrease this happiness are immoral.
For coming up with objective moral truths, I trust Sam far more than any gods or religious people. Science and philosophy can advance, while religions are stuck with old "holy" books often filled with torture and killing by the gods or in the name of the gods, and rules that decrease the happiness and
well-being of many people.
Questions of good and evil, right and wrong are commonly thought unanswerable by science. But Sam argues that science can — and should — be an authority on moral issues, shaping human values and setting out what constitutes a good life. See his talk and article

“Democracy demands that the religiously motivated translate their concerns into universal, rather than
religion-specific, values. It requires that their proposals be subject to argument, and amenable to reason.
I may be opposed to abortion for religious reasons, but if I seek to pass a law banning the practice, I cannot
simply point to the teachings of my church or evoke God's will. I have to explain why abortion violates some
principle that is accessible to people of all faiths, including those with no faith at all.”
- Sen. Barack Obama, 6/28/06
